Meridian Family Foot And Ankle Clinic Pllc is a medicare enrolled "Podiatrist - Foot & Ankle Surgery" provider in Okc, Oklahoma. Their current practice location is 13301 N. Meridian, Suite 701, Okc, Oklahoma. You can reach out to their office (for appointments etc.) via phone at (405) 751-6152.

Meridian Family Foot And Ankle Clinic Pllc is licensed to practice in Oklahoma (license number 250) and it also participates in the medicare program. Meridian Family Foot And Ankle Clinic Pllc is enrolled with medicare and should accept medicare assignments and since they are enrolled in medicare, they may order Medicare Part D Prescription drugs, if eligible. The facility's NPI Number is 1760754428.

Smoking cessation after liver transplantation reduces incidence of malignancy

Spanish researchers have found that liver transplant recipients who quit smoking have a lower incidence of smoking-related malignancies (SRM) than patients who keep smoking. In fact, SRMs were identified in 13.5% of deceased patients and smoking was associated with a higher risk of malignancy in this study. Full findings are published in the April issue of Liver Transplantation, a journal of the American Association for the Study of Liver Diseases.

Medicare Part D Prescriber Enrollment

Any physician or other eligible professional who prescribes Part D drugs must either enroll in the Medicare program or opt out in order to prescribe drugs to their patients with Part D prescription drug benefit plans. Meridian Family Foot And Ankle Clinic Pllc is enrolled with medicare and thus, if eligible, can prescribe medicare part D drugs to patients with medicare part D benefits.
